The Dynatrace SaaS release notes for version 1.275, published on October 11, 2023, outline several new features, enhancements, and changes to the platform. Notably, the introduction of Dynatrace EdgeConnect facilitates secure connections between local systems and the Dynatrace analytics platform, addressing automation use cases with internet-restricted systems. The retired Thresholds API functionality has been moved to metric events within the Settings API, and Microsoft has retired certain Azure API Management request metrics, impacting dashboards and alerts based on them. The update also includes extended management zone awareness for risk assessments, new DQL commands, functions, and operators, as well as infrastructure observability improvements for VMware and Kubernetes. Additionally, the release resolves six key issues and provides cumulative updates, ensuring enhanced user experience and functionality across different components of the platform.
